Realistic Flight Simulators: Step Into the Captain's Seat

Ever wondered what it feels like to be responsible for hundreds of passengers at 30,000 feet? Civilian aviation games put you in exactly that position. You'll monitor airspeed, altitude, landing gear, flaps, and a host of other systems to ensure every takeoff and landing goes off without a hitch.

A standout example is TU-46. Here, you take command of a compact passenger airliner — throttling up the engines, managing pitch, raising and lowering the landing gear, keeping a close eye on engine health, and doing everything in your power to get everyone on board home safely.

This one plays close to a classic flight simulator: one wrong move can spiral into an emergency, making focus and precision your most valuable co-pilots.

Tactical Air Combat and Strategy

If you crave the thrill of commanding the skies through careful planning rather than raw reflexes, tactical air combat games are calling your name. Here, it's less about reaction time and more about plotting smart maneuvers, choosing the right approach vector, and anticipating your enemy's next move before they make it.

Drop into Steam Birds to test your skills as an aerial strategist. You'll plot your aircraft's heading, speed, and maneuvers in advance, then watch your plan unfold in real time — tweaking and refining your tactics with each passing round.

Every call you make could mean the difference between victory and losing your entire squadron.
